Cagrilintide

Synonyms / Designations: Cagrilintide, AM833, Long-acting amylin analogue, Dual amylin receptor agonist
CAS Number:1415456-99-3
Molecular Formula: C194H312N54O59S2
Molecular Weight: 4409.01 g/mol
Peptide Classification: Synthetic long-acting amylin analogue
Purity: ≥ 99 % (HPLC, typical)
Appearance: White to off-white lyophilised powder
Pack Size: Research pack size (varies)
Storage: Desiccated, protected from light, stored at –20 °C
Solubility: Soluble in sterile water and buffered aqueous solutions

Description & Mechanism

Cagrilintide is a synthetic long-acting analogue of the endogenous peptide hormone amylin, developed for experimental investigation of amylin receptor signalling and metabolic regulation. Structural modifications to the native amylin sequence enhance stability and prolong systemic persistence in research models.

In biochemical and cellular research systems, cagrilintide interacts with amylin receptors formed by calcitonin receptor complexes, activating downstream signalling pathways involved in appetite regulation, gastric emptying, and metabolic homeostasis. Experimental studies focus on receptor binding characteristics, signal transduction dynamics, and pathway modulation under controlled conditions. Observed molecular responses are dependent on experimental design, concentration, and model system, and are used to investigate peptide-mediated signalling rather than defined biological or clinical outcomes.

Handling, Reconstitution & Stability

  • Weigh under dry conditions; peptide is hygroscopic
  • Reconstitute in sterile water or appropriate buffered aqueous solution depending on assay requirements
  • Avoid vigorous agitation during dissolution
  • Filter sterilize if required (e.g. 0.22 µm) immediately prior to use
  • Aliquot and store reconstituted solutions at –20 °C (or lower) to minimise degradation
  • Avoid repeated freeze–thaw cycles
